By default, WordPress usages ‘WordPress’ as the sender name for all outgoing WordPress notification emails. This doesn’t look very professional, and you may want to change that to your business name. This plugin will let you easily change the default sender name and email address in outgoing WordPress emails.

WordPress sends several email notifications to the site administrator as well as other users on your website. This includes email notifications such as forgot password emails, website error and recovery emails, new user registration, and more. As WordPress usages (WordPress) as the sender’s name and a non-existent email address ([email protected]) as the sender email. Many spam filters block your WordPress emails believing them to be spam. Sometimes it does not even make it to the spam folder.

The outgoing email notifications are important, and you should use your own brand name and email address. This can increase the authenticity of your brand. And here has the Actignite: Change Sender Name and Email Address in Outgoing WordPress Email, has the role to play.

WordPress EMAIL’S DEFAULT NAME AND EMAIL ADDRESS CUSTOMIZER – ACTIGNITE FEATURES IN DETAILS

After activating the plugin, you will notice a new menu item labeled CB Mail Sender in your WordPress admin bar. Clicking on it will take you to the plugin’s Settings page. You will need to enter the name and email address you want to be used for outgoing WordPress emails. Now click on the save changes button to store your settings.

That’s all, by doing these your WordPress notification emails will now show the name and email address you entered in plugin settings.
